The administration of the Federal Urdu University of Arts, Science and Technology (FUUAST) has banned all student organizations, warning that the admissions of the students found involved violating the order will be cancelled.

However, the student organizations have expressed concern over the FUUAST decision.

In a statement issued by the acting registrar, it has been said that a ban has been imposed on student organizations in the university and the student organizations will not be allowed to engage in teaching and non-teaching activities.

According to the statement, strict action will be taken against the students who do not follow the order, while the admission of the students who violate the order will also be canceled immediately.

The Islami Jamiat Talaba and People’s Students Federation (PSF) have expressed concern over the decision.

A spokesperson for the Islami Jamiat Talaba said that banning student organizations is like suppressing the voice of students. The People’s Students Federation said that the ban on the activities of student organizations is not acceptable. PSF warned of protests against the decision at every forum.
